| Ramp Closure Planned At Exit 8 Of I-93 In Manchester
To Allow For Bridge Joint Work Near Stevens Pond The New Hampshire Department of Transportation (NHDOT) announces that ramp closures are planned at Exit 8 of Interstate 93 in Manchester to allow for bridge work near Stevens Pond. The Exit 8 southbound on-ramp will be closed for eight weeks for bridge expansion joint replacement work from Monday, April 2 to Friday, May 25, 2012. Message boards will alert motorists to the planned ramp closure. Detour signs will be in place to direct traffic to use the Exit 8 northbound on-ramp to Exit 9S (south) and then reverse direction. Pike Industries, Inc. of Belmont, New Hampshire is the general contractor for the $6.2 million roadway and bridge rehabilitation project, which has a final completion date of September 28, 2012. |
